As Motor magazine learned, the cost will be 128,800 Belarusian rubles – that’s 3.47 million Russian rubles. All versions of the Chinese new product are equipped with a CATL Kirin battery with a capacity of 87.3 kWh, with which the range ranges from 660 to 720 km.
The base version is a rear-wheel drive single-engine version with a power of 340 hp. The dual-motor all-wheel drive has an output of 544 hp, thanks to which acceleration to 100 km/h takes a sports car in 4.5 seconds.
The length of the Li i6 crossover is 4950 mm, width – 1935 mm, height – 1655 mm, and the distance between the axles is 3000 mm. The machine is based on a modern 800-volt electrical architecture.
In China, sales of the model started last fall, and now the new product has become available to residents of Belarus. The first deliveries will begin this spring – approximately in March-April.
